Grand Rounds 2025

We were privileged to welcome Hannah McPierzie at the Royal Children’s Hospital Grand Rounds on the 3rd of December 2025, to celebrate and honour International Day of People with Disability (IDPwD).

Hannah is a disability rights advocate, harnessing her experience from her personal journey and as a teacher of children with disability.

In her presentation, Hannah shared her personal journey following her diagnosis with a rare neurological condition, Neurofibromatosis Type 2, leading to deaf blindness. Through her story, Hannah provided important insights into systems and processes which overlook individuals with alternative communication needs, as well as providing practical suggestions on how to improve them.

Hannah’s presentation contributed strongly to the IDPwD theme of fostering disability-inclusive societies for advancing social progress by building awareness of the barriers in the health services system which disables people with alternative communication needs. Hannah called for co-design in health service delivery to ensure equity for people with a disability.
